Understanding the Role of a Sand Trap Chamber in Water Treatment

What Does a Sand Trap Chamber Do?

A sand trap chamber is a key component in residential and commercial water treatment setups. Its primary function is to slow down the flow of water, allowing larger heavy particles such as sand, grit, and sediment to settle at the bottom of the chamber. This pre-filtration process helps to maintain cleaner water downstream, reducing wear and tear on your entire water system and preventing clogs and blockages.

Maintenance and Cleaning

Routine inspection and maintenance are important to keep your sediment filter functioning effectively. Typically, this involves periodically removing accumulated sediment from the bottom of the chamber. This process is usually straightforward, involving opening access ports or removing a drain plug—details to be specified by your equipment installer.

Seasonal Changes in the Supply

The water supply in Centennial, CO, experiences notable changes throughout the year due to varying weather conditions and runoff patterns. In the spring, melting snow and increased rainfall can significantly elevate sediment levels in local water sources. This surge often leads to higher concentrations of silt and sand, making it essential for homeowners to employ effective filtration solutions, such as a sand trap retention tank and sediment filter, to address the resulting turbidity.

During the summer, evaporation and lower rainfall can decrease sediment influx, but dust and debris can still contribute to water quality issues. Fall and winter may bring additional challenges, as leaves and other organic matter enter the water supply. Understanding these seasonal changes allows homeowners to anticipate potential sediment issues and adjust their water treatment strategies accordingly, ensuring a continuous supply of clear water year-round.
